Как перезапустить mongodb в случае перезагрузки сервера?

Пользователь

от jensen , в категории: SQL , 8 месяцев назад

Как перезапустить mongodb в случае перезагрузки сервера?

Facebook Vk Ok Twitter LinkedIn Telegram Whatsapp

1 ответ

Пользователь

от rebekah , 7 месяцев назад

@jensen 

Для перезапуска MongoDB после перезагрузки сервера можно использовать следующие шаги, в зависимости от используемой операционной системы:

Для системы Linux

  1. Откройте терминал и введите команду sudo systemctl restart mongodb для перезапуска MongoDB.
  2. Чтобы убедиться, что MongoDB был успешно перезапущен, введите команду sudo systemctl status mongodb. Если MongoDB работает, вы должны увидеть сообщение о том, что сервис запущен.

Для системы Windows

  1. Откройте командную строку или PowerShell с правами администратора.
  2. Введите команду "C:Program FilesMongoDBServer{версия}inmongod.exe" --config "C:Program FilesMongoDBServer{версия}inmongod.cfg" --service, заменив {версия} на версию MongoDB, которую вы установили.
  3. Чтобы убедиться, что MongoDB был успешно перезапущен, введите команду "C:Program FilesMongoDBServer{версия}inmongo.exe" для запуска интерфейса командной строки MongoDB. Затем введите команду db.version() для проверки версии MongoDB.


При перезагрузке сервера MongoDB может быть настроена для автоматического запуска при старте системы. Если вы хотите настроить автоматический запуск MongoDB, то для системы Linux вам нужно выполнить команду sudo systemctl enable mongodb, а для системы Windows - установить MongoDB как службу с помощью команды "C:Program FilesMongoDBServer{версия}inmongod.exe" --config "C:Program FilesMongoDBServer{версия}inmongod.cfg" --install.